For example, to read seconds from the real-time clock:
Step 1 – Enter 0xA2 into the Slave Address[W] block in the Read section of the Basic
Operations window (top half of window)
Step 2 – Enter 0x02 into the Word Address block
Step 3 – Note that the Slave Address[R] has already been entered for you (the Read
bit is set).
Step 4 – Enter 0x01 into the Byte Count block
Step 5 – Click on the Execute button
The I
2
C combination command (Write then Read) will be sent to the 28-Pin Demo
Board. The command and the contents of Word Address 0x02 (seconds) will be
displayed in the transaction window as shown in Figure 2-7.

2.8.2 EEPROM
The Slave address for the emulated Serial EEPROM on the 28-Pin Demo Board is
hexadecimal A8 (0xA8). The Word Address selects one of 256 8-bit memory locations:

2.8.3 ADC
The Slave address for the ADC on the 28-Pin Demo Board is hexadecimal AA (0xAA).
The Word Address 0x01 selects the memory location containing the Most Significant 8
bits of the 10-bit ADC of the PIC microcontroller.
